Evidence-Based Strategies That Really Work

Direct Exposure and Action Prevention treatment stands for the gold criterion for OCD treatment, with years of study sustaining its efficiency. Unlike traditional talk therapy that could accidentally enhance uncontrollable behaviors, ERP directly deals with the cycle of fixations and obsessions by slowly revealing people to anxiety-triggering situations while preventing the usual compulsive response. This technique retrains the brain's danger detection system, aiding customers develop tolerance to uncertainty and discomfort without turning to routines or avoidance actions.

Quality OCD therapy carriers recognize that contamination concerns, invasive ideas, checking actions, and mental compulsions all require customized exposure power structures. The therapist's role entails carefully building these pecking orders, beginning with reasonably challenging direct exposures and slowly proceeding toward circumstances that previously appeared difficult to face. This organized desensitization, incorporated with cognitive restructuring, produces long-term adjustment as opposed to momentary relief.

The crossway in between anxiety conditions and disordered eating commonly goes unknown, yet these problems frequently exist side-by-side. Limiting consuming, binge habits, and food-related routines can all function as stress and anxiety administration methods that eventually aggravate mental health and wellness end results. Efficient therapy addresses both the consuming habits and the underlying anxiousness driving them, acknowledging that restriction usually represents an effort to regulate unpredictability or manage overwhelming feelings.

Specialists specializing in this location use a combination of direct exposure treatment for food fears, cognitive behavioral strategies for distorted thinking patterns, and mindfulness-based strategies to enhance understanding of appetite signs and psychological triggers. Rather than focusing entirely on weight remediation or meal plans, comprehensive treatment checks out the feature these actions serve in the client's life and develops much healthier coping devices for taking care of distress.

ADHD Therapy: Beyond Medication Management

5/5

While medicine can be practical for ADHD symptom monitoring, treatment addresses the executive functioning challenges, psychological dysregulation, and self-esteem concerns that medicine alone can not resolve. Reliable ADHD therapy includes business ability advancement, time management methods, and strategies for managing impulsivity and emotional sensitivity. Many individuals with ADHD also have problem with stress and anxiety, specifically around performance expectations or social situations, calling for an integrated therapy technique.

Teenage years brings distinct mental health and wellness obstacles, with anxiety, depression, and identity formation issues frequently peaking during these years. Reliable teen treatment acknowledges that youths aren't simply little grownups-- their developmental phase requires approaches that value their expanding autonomy while supplying suitable support and structure. Therapists functioning with teens must stabilize collaboration with parents while maintaining healing confidentiality, developing a room where adolescents really feel safe sharing their experiences.

Concerns like institution anxiety, public opinions, household dispute, and identification exploration require therapists that really get in touch with young people as opposed to talking down to them. The most reliable teen therapists integrate the teenage's rate of interests and communication choices right into therapy, whether that includes walk-and-talk sessions, art-based interventions, or incorporating relevant media right into restorative discussions. Building genuine connection often matters much more than perfect strategy application when collaborating with this age.

Injury influences the nerve system in means that speak treatment alone can not constantly address. Whether handling single-incident injury or complicated developmental injury, reliable therapy requires recognizing just how previous experiences continue impacting existing working. Lots of people with trauma backgrounds develop anxiety problems or OCD as attempts to protect against future injury or take care of overwhelming feelings linked to stressful memories.

Evidence-based trauma treatments like EMDR (Eye Motion Desensitization and Reprocessing), trauma-focused CBT, and somatic experiencing help customers procedure stressful memories without coming to be overloaded or retraumatized. These methods recognize that injury lives in the body as well as the mind, incorporating anxious system policy methods alongside cognitive processing. The goal isn't to neglect what took place but to reduce the emotional fee and intrusive nature of stressful memories, enabling customers to incorporate their experiences instead of staying regulated by them.
